2018 has been a good year for Henry Golding. Not only is he starring in Monsoonand A Simple Favor, but the Crazy Rich Asians leading man has also been cast as Emilia Clarke’s love interest in Universal’s Last Christmas.
The film’s plot is yet to be revealed, but we do know that it is a holiday romance set in London. Paul Feig (Bridesmaids, Ghostbusters, A Simple Favor) will be helming the project, making this his second collaboration with Golding. Emma Thompson and Bryony Kimmings are writing the script, and Thompson will also be producing alongside David Livingstone.

Golding’s breakout role in Crazy Rich Asians has skyrocketed him into international fame. It’s no surprise he is starring in another romance story, considering that Crazy Rich Asians had the no. 1 spot at the box office for three weeks in a row, becoming the top-grossing comedy at the domestic box office in two years.

Clarke currently plays Daenerys Targaryen in HBO’s Game of Thrones and will finish production on the hit show in 2019. She recently appeared on the big screen as Q’ira in Solo: A Star Wars Story.
